Asst. AC Mechanic
Job Description
Job Description: React.js Frontend Developer
Position Overview
We are seeking a skilled React.js Frontend Developer to join our development team. The ideal candidate will be responsible for building responsive web applications, integrating APIs, and collaborating with designers and backend developers to deliver high-quality user experiences.
Key Responsibilities
Develop and maintain user-facing features using React.js.
Build reusable components and frontend libraries for future use.
Integrate RESTful APIs and third-party services.
Optimize applications for maximum speed and scalability.
Collaborate with UI/UX designers to implement responsive designs.
Write clean, maintainable, and well-documented code.
Troubleshoot and debug application issues.
Participate in code reviews and team discussions.
Ensure cross-browser compatibility and mobile responsiveness.
Required Skills
Strong proficiency in JavaScript (ES6+).
Experience with React.js and React Hooks.
Knowledge of HTML5, CSS3, and responsive design principles.
Experience with API integration using Axios or Fetch.
Familiarity with state management libraries such as Redux or Context API.
Understanding of Git version control.
Basic knowledge of Node.js and REST APIs.
Preferred Qualifications
Experience with TypeScript.
Familiarity with Vite, Next.js, or modern frontend build tools.
Knowledge of Material UI, Tailwind CSS, or Bootstrap.
Experience working in Agile/Scrum environments.
Understanding of authentication mechanisms such as JWT and OAuth.
Education & Experience
Bachelor's degree in Computer Science, Information Technology, or related field.
1–3 years of experience in frontend web development.
Freshers with strong React.js project experience are encouraged to apply.
Benefits
Competitive salary package.
Flexible work environment.
Professional development opportunities.
Health insurance and paid leave.
Collaborative and innovative team culture.